N2 - In this study, a system is developed which communicates through GSM mobile phones and provides protection for interviews against third parties including with service providers developed. GSM line is sensitive to human speech to be more efficient and provide more quality for transmission. In addition, a tool should be used to compress speech to transmit speech over GSM. For these reasons, speech cannot be transmitted to the GSM line directly after encrypted. In this study, the encrypted speech which is a digital data stream, formed speech like waveform by the designed coder to transmit through the GSM line. FPGA implementation of AES is used for encryption of digital data stream. Desired speech characteristics are obtained by scanning the database of NTIMIT, and then LBG algorithm is used to design codebooks which include speech parameters. A coder is designed to synthesize speech like waveforms from the encrypted digital data stream.
